Recommended Ball Mount For Towing a U-Haul Trailer With a Vehicle Receiver Height of 23"  

Question:

The trailer receiver in my suv is 23” tall. The uhaul trailer I will be pulling in a few months are said to be 18.5” tall. The trailer 5’x8’ will have about 500 pounds of equipment in it and I will be driving about 600 miles with it. Would I be ok with a hitch that has only a 2 inch drop or should I buy something to make it as level as possible. Is making the trailer level more important with heavy loads or is it something to always pay attention to? Thanks

Expert Reply:

I recommend using the Curt Fusion Ball Mount # C45154 for towing the U-Haul trailer with your SUV. This ball mount has a 4" drop to help level the trailer. It is important to level the trailer as best as possible when towing. Having the trailer level will help reduce the chances of the contents moving around and will help prevent damage to the trailer if the rear of the trailer is to close to the ground. It can also prevent you from being able to back into some driveways on hills if the rear of the trailer is too low.
